Morro Da Babilônia
The Morro da Babilônia (, ''Babylon Hill'') is a hill in the Leme neighbourhood of Rio de Janeiro, separating Copacabana beach from Botafogo. It is home to a ''favela'' known by the same name, as well as the favela Chapéu Mangueira. Morro da Babilônia is an environmentally protected area. History In the 18th century the Portuguese constructed a fortress on the top of the hill to protect the entrance to Guanabara Bay.Na trilha das lendas

In the beginning of the 20th century, the engineer Augusto Ferreira Ramos, projected a connection of Babilônia hill with Urca Hill, as part of the festivities of Centenary of Ports Opening.
